@@ -89,15 +89,18 @@ SRD_PKGLIBS_TESTS=
 SR_PKG_CHECK_SUMMARY([srd_pkglibs_summary])
 
 # Python 3 is always needed.
+# Starting with Python 3.8 we need to check for "python-3.8-embed"
+# first, since usually only that variant will add "-lpython3.8".
+# https://docs.python.org/3/whatsnew/3.8.html#debug-build-uses-the-same-abi-as-release-build
 SR_PKG_CHECK([python3], [SRD_PKGLIBS],
-       [python3 >= 3.2], [python-3.7 >= 3.7], [python-3.6 >= 3.6], [python-3.5 >= 3.5], [python-3.4 >= 3.4], [python-3.3 >= 3.3], [python-3.2 >= 3.2])
+       [python-3.8-embed], [python-3.8 >= 3.8], [python-3.7 >= 3.7], [python-3.6 >= 3.6], [python-3.5 >= 3.5], [python-3.4 >= 3.4], [python-3.3 >= 3.3], [python-3.2 >= 3.2], [python3 >= 3.2])
 AS_IF([test "x$sr_have_python3" = xno],
        [AC_MSG_ERROR([Cannot find Python 3 development headers.])])
